5. Permits
If a skip is to be placed on public property (e.g. a road), a council permit is required.
We can arrange the permit on your behalf for an additional fee.
Permit approval is subject to local authority discretion.
6. Customer Responsibilities
Ensure adequate space for safe delivery and collection of the skip.
Do not overload skips beyond the fill line.
Skips must not contain prohibited materials, including:
Asbestos
Paint, solvents, or liquids
Electrical equipment
Gas cylinders
Tyres
Customers are liable for any penalties arising from misuse or incorrect use of skips.
